Contribution to the Trust. For the purpose of guaranteeing (i) the negative covenants provided for in Section 2.4 above; (ii) the obligation of the Strategic Partner not to vote more than 10% (ten percent) of the Shares, and that the Shares exceeding such percentage are voted in the same manner as the majority of the Shares into which the capital stock of the Holding Company is divided; and (iii) the obligations set forth in the Technical Assistance Agreement, the Strategic Partner, the Holding Company and the Trustee agree to execute on this same date the Trust Agreement, in which the Trustee shall act as such, the Strategic Partner shall act as settlor and first beneficiary, and the Holding Company shall act as second beneficiary. By virtue of such Trust Agreement, the Strategic Partner shall contribute the Shares Package to the Trustee, in order that such shares are kept in the Trust. Likewise, the obligation of the Strategic Partner to contribute to the Trust the Optional Shares it may acquire shall be set forth.

Contribution to the Trust. Following the date of this Agreement and during the Trust Term (as defined in Section 3), the Trust shall have legal and record ownership, of the initial assets consisting of $10 contributed by the Grantor (the “Trust Assets”). Except as provided herein, no other property may be contributed to the Trust by any party without the prior written agreement of the Operating Trustees.

  • Contribution Payment To the extent the indemnification provided for under any provision of this Agreement is determined (in the manner hereinabove provided) not to be permitted under applicable law, the Company, in lieu of indemnifying Indemnitee, shall, to the extent permitted by law, contribute to the amount of any and all Indemnifiable Liabilities incurred or paid by Indemnitee for which such indemnification is not permitted. The amount the Company contributes shall be in such proportion as is appropriate to reflect the relative fault of Indemnitee, on the one hand, and of the Company and any and all other parties (including officers and directors of the Company other than Indemnitee) who may be at fault (collectively, including the Company, the "Third Parties"), on the other hand.
